GitHub Code Quality Goes Paid July 20: What Teams Should Audit Now
GitHub Code Quality becomes a paid product on July 20, adding a $10-per-active-committer license, GitHub AI Credits for AI-powered checks, and GitHub Actions minutes for CodeQL scans. Teams using the free preview should audit enabled repositories, active committers, Actions usage, AI review behavior, and merge-blocking rules before billing starts.
Microsoft MDASH Moves AI Bug Hunting Into Real Security Workflows
Microsoft says its MDASH agentic security system is now being used across Windows, Azure, and identity workflows, with new findings in Hyper-V, HTTP.sys, the Windows kernel, and Active Directory. The update shows AI vulnerability discovery moving from benchmark claims toward real engineering pipelines, while proof generation remains the hard part.
